ex·alt ( g-zôlt )tr.v. ex·alt·ed, ex·alt·ing, ex·alts 1. To raise in rank, character, or status; elevate: exalted the shepherd to the rank of grand vizier. 2. To glorify, praise, or honor. 3. To increase the effect or intensity of; heighten: works of art that exalt the imagination. 4. Obsolete To fill with sublime emotion; elate.
[Middle English exalten, from Latin exalt re : ex-, up, away; see ex- + altus, high; see al-2 in Indo-European roots.]
ex·alt er n. |
exalt Verb 1. to praise highly 2. to raise to a higher rank [Latin exaltare to raise] exalted adjexaltation nUSAGE: Exalt is sometimes wrongly used where exult is meant: he was exulting (not exalting) in his win earlier that day.
